Author: sam
Date: Wed Jan 28 19:18:58 2009
New Revision: 187842
URL: http://svn.freebsd.org/changeset/base/187842

Log:
  improve debug msgs for regdomain operations; print channel flags
  symbolically so it's easier to identify channels and why they
  are added (or not)

Modified:
  head/sbin/ifconfig/ifieee80211.c
